The use of corticosteroids in severe community-acquired pneumonia (sCAP) management is a contentious issue with current practices of United Kingdom (UK) intensivists largely unknown. To investigate this, we surveyed UK intensive care clinicians from 20 September 2024 to 19 December 2024, collecting 160 responses from 115 intensive care units (response rate 48.3%). 56.1% of responders use corticosteroids in the treatment of sCAP. There were large variabilities in practice. Hydrocortisone started within 24 h of admission 50 mg four times a day for 4-5 days was the most reported regime. The variation in practice coupled with relative equipoise requires further evaluation and guidance.
